Output 6695be85fa6e521df510b999de7064d40c043ec6242aa9e5de482ec36c7a0983:11

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a6c34fc08edda4f67e8d6ffc15901ee8255cd24 OP_EQUAL
address
3HE8RWMzoQrv1Y1qgSTnT6TC8XV9ZhHBLv
transaction
6695be85fa6e521df510b999de7064d40c043ec6242aa9e5de482ec36c7a0983
spent
true